Iran may privatize small ports

Business Materials 27 December 2015 14:53 (UTC +04:00)

Tehran, Iran, December 27

By Mehdi Sepahvand - Trend:

Iranian Ports and Navigation Organization is seeking to introduce a bill within the Sixth Development Plan that would privatize small ports, Mohammad Saidnejad, CEO of the organization said.

Operation of various contractors in one port can create problems in their privatization, the official said, ISNA news agency reported Dec. 27.

Moreover, the privatization will reduce the size and responsibilities of the government, helping it focus on policy-making, investment, and supervision rather than executive affairs.

The official, however, did not point out how many of Iran's 180 small ports will be privatized, or how private entities would qualify for owning the ports.

Iranian government is oversized and poses many problems since it is active in many corners where the private sector could handle jobs.

Iranian Privatization Organization has transferred $150 billion of governmental assets in the past ten years.
